Output d66f7185cf03e5090c673445d5b5a496ef36a8a627b0d6e520e85efca742d6ba:0

value
227958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5be5923e4c8f8d9cefb4a34811043851d8481cb OP_EQUAL
address
3JFzFtaepPzAtXy7CKwvg6S76cjPkJoqgR
transaction
d66f7185cf03e5090c673445d5b5a496ef36a8a627b0d6e520e85efca742d6ba
spent
true